Oil prices are in the midst of a historic oil price rally, with both WTI and Brent soaring by close to 30% on the back of a major escalation in the Iran conflict, with energy infrastructure around the region being targeted. At the time of writing, WTI crude was trading at $117.50, up 29.21%, while Brent crude had risen to $117.60, up 26.90%. Attacks on energy infrastructure and military targets across the region are heightening fears that oil flows from the Middle East could be disrupted for weeks.
